Warren Boyd – The Real Cleaner

Have you seen the new A&E show “The Cleaner?” It features Benjamin Bratt as a former addict who now uses extreme measures to help other addicts get clean. If you’ve seen the show, you may not know that Benjamin’s character, William Banks, is based on a real person. Warren Boyd was raised in sunny Santa Rosa, California, but by the age of 32, he had seen his share of trouble. He had nine DUI convictions and had already spent five years in prison. Addicted to both alcohol and cocaine, Boyd had been in and out of 26 rehab programs without … Continue reading

The Betty Ford Center: 25 Years Later

I don’t even think I knew what a rehab center was until the Betty Ford Center came into being. Former First Lady Betty Ford decided to open the drug and alcohol rehabilitation center in Rancho Mirage, California along with Ambassador Leonard Firestone. It opened its doors in 1982, which makes this year the 25th anniversary of its opening. Why would someone so visible in the public eye open such a center? The First Lady decided to do it because she had fought an addiction and wanted a center that emphasized the needs of women as well as men. The center … Continue reading
